top 12 places to submit your tshirt ideas

UPDATE - new updated article available here!

So you have a Tshirt idea. Threadless rules, but there are a stack of other sites out there asking for your tshirt ideas. The rewards can vary enormously depending on where you send your design - anything from a sticker, to one off cash payments to a cut of all Tshirt sales.

So which site gives best value for you? You need to weight up a few factors:

So below are links to the submissions pages of 20 sites offering to print your shirt. Any experiences of submitting to these would be vastly useful - comment below. The list:

jinx.jpgJ!NX Shirts
J!nx are very geek focussed, a typical shirt featuring an RPG joke. They offer $100 for an idea, $400 for the artwork if they use it.

threadlogo.gifThreadless
Now offering $2000 worth of benefits ($1500 cash, the rest essentially in Tees). Competition is fierce on Threadless, but if you get a shirt printed you instantly become a shirt design legend among your peers.


Cafepress
You don’t so much submit your design to cafepress, as just publish it. You take a cut of everything sold. Cafepress has some sweet designs on it, but you do risk simply sinking into the clutter unless you put some effort into an affiliate style site to promo your shirt. Potentially higher rewards, but you have to do most of the promotional work yourself.

NerdyShirts
$200 for a shirt design, $50 for a slogan. They do promise a quick response though - “if you win, you’ll get an email on monday”. And if you want a portfolio piece, they take some nice promo pics!

flag_bustedtees.gifBusted Tees
Busted have a simple policy “just send it to us at ideas@bustedtees.com and if we like it we’ll give you $150 and a shirt with your idea on it too!”. You can’t say fairer than that.

tshirthell.jpgTShirt Hell
An edgy shirt site, TShirt hell may be a home for your more… out there ideas. $200 plus 10 shirts of your choice is on offer. Picking 10 shirts won’t be a problem, $200 is typical, and you get a different kind of cool point here!

shocker.jpgShocker Tees
If tshirt hell blushed when you showed them your idea, try shocker. They print anything! $150 for your idea. Cool points? Perhaps. Infamy? Guaranteed.

thoseshirts.jpgThoseshirts.com
“where conservative humor, superior quality, and professional artistry come together.”. $200 for your idea, so if you have a great Clinton gag, or firearm pun, this may be the best place to try.

splitatom.jpgSplit the atom
A slightly above average $250 is on offer here for your submission. Guidelines, templates etc… are all particularly good although I find the flash site a pain to use on my laptop. User voting a la threadless is also used on split the atom.

oyb.jpgOff Your Back Shirts
OYB shirts offers a $100 voucher plus 2 of your shirts. Some pretty ‘worthy’ shirts on offer, so if you have a cutting comment on our tv obsessed lives in the form of a 16″x16″ square - you my have found it’s home.

unit-shirts.gifUneetee.com
This is a pretty unique site, operating a single lead design at any one time. It offers $2 per shirt sold with your design on it, so if it sells a few thousand you’ll be better off here than at Threadless. I like the JENIUS shirt.
